Witryna27 lis 2024 · New York Holiday Markets –. - Union Square Holiday Market - November 17 to December 24. - Holiday shops at Bryant Park - October 28 to January 2. - Columbus Circle Holiday Market - November 28 to December 24. - Brooklyn Borough Hall Holiday Market - November 28 to December 26.
